A 2000 Buick LeSabre typically requires about 2 to 2.5 pounds of R-134a refrigerant, which is approximately equivalent to 1 to 1.5 cans of the standard 12-ounce refrigerant cans. It's essential to check the system's specifications and any service guidelines for precise requirements. Always ensure the system is properly evacuated and serviced by a qualified technician.
